Directions

Melt butter in chafing dish.

Add brown sugar and blend well.

Add bananas and sauté lightly.

Sprinkle with cinnamon and lower flame.

Pour rum and banana liqueur over bananas.

Ignite carefully, basting bananas with flaming liquid.

Serve over ice cream when flame dies out.

**Caution is the rule whenever liquors are ignited.

Flames beneath pan must be low-or the pan removed from flame entirely-to protect against accidents.

** Tip: Bananas must be ripe for this recipe.
